Finding the Right Legal Representative for You

How does one choose the right attorney among a sea of choices? The process begins by assessing distinct legal needs, as different attorneys specialize in various fields such as family law, criminal defense, or corporate issues. Once the area of expertise is determined, individuals can seek referrals from reliable sources, including friends, family, or professional-level networks. Online resources, such as legal directories and review platforms, also give valuable information into an attorney's reputation and client satisfaction.

After refining choices, prospective clients should book initial meetings to assess compatibility. Important questions might cover the attorney's timely resource expertise with similar cases, their method of communicating with clients, and pricing models. This engagement provides a insight into the attorney's professional manner and grasp of the client's concerns. Finally, choosing the right attorney depends on a mix of competence, trust, and effective communication, guaranteeing that your rights and interests receive proper representation.

Understanding Law Expenses: What to Expect?

Knowing about legal costs is key for anyone seeking out professional law office services. Several varieties of legal fees, such as hourly rates and flat fees, greatly impact overall expenses. In addition, factors like case level of difficulty and location have a significant effect in setting the final costs.

Law Fee Varieties

Legal expenses can often appear daunting, but they are a vital component of engaging with professional legal services. Different kinds of legal expenses exist, each adapted to different legal needs and situations. Hourly rates are prevalent, where clients pay for the real time lawyers dedicate to their cases. Flat fees are another alternative, offering a set cost for particular services, such as creating a will or handling a divorce. Performance-based fees allow attorneys to receive a portion of the settlement, making them appealing in injury litigation. In addition, retainer fees obligate clients to provide payment for continuous services. Understanding these fee structures helps clients choose wisely when choosing attorney services, guaranteeing transparency and confidence in the arrangement.

Determinants Shaping Expenses

Dealing with the complications of legal costs requires awareness of several key factors. Geographic location plays a significant role, as legal fees can differ significantly between urban and rural areas. The experience level of the solicitor also impacts costs; seasoned professionals may charge higher rates due to their skill. Additionally, the intricacy of the case influences expenses; intricate matters typically necessitate more time and resources. The nature of the legal service—be it litigation, consultation, or contract drafting—also affects pricing structures. Moreover, overhead costs associated with maintaining a law office, such as staff salaries and technology, contribute to overall fees. Understanding these factors helps clients plan their legal expenses effectively.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Should I Do to Prepare for My Initial Appointment With a Legal Professional?

In advance of a first meeting with a lawyer, gather relevant documents, pinpoint key questions, define objectives, note important dates, and contemplate personal goals to make certain a productive discussion.

What Should I Need to Bring to My Legal Meeting?

When attending a legal consultation, you should carry identification, important files, a collection of inquiries, any communications about your situation, and a notepad for notes. Thorough preparation strengthens comprehension and facilitates effective communication with the lawyer.

What Approaches Do Attorneys Use to Communicate With Their Clients?

Attorneys usually engage with clients across different platforms, including phone calls, emails, and in-person meetings. They maintain clarity by clarifying legal matters, providing updates, and addressing client concerns to establish a strong attorney-client relationship.

Is It Possible to change My Counsel if I'm Displeased?

Yes, an person can switch their lawyer if unsatisfied. It is advisable to copyrightine the conditions of the current agreement and discuss concerns openly. Hiring a different lawyer may enhance contentment and strengthen legal representation.

What will happen if I cannot fund legal services?

If someone is unable to pay for legal services, they may explore options like free legal services, legal aid organizations, or flexible payment arrangements with attorneys. Additionally, some courts provide self-help resources for handling legal matters on your own.
